Story

In 1570, Oribela, a young orphan girl from Portugal, is sent to Brazil to marry Francisco de Albuquerque, an older sugar beet plantation owner. Despite Francisco's love for her, their marriage is strained due to his rude nature and the peculiar household he shares with his mother and sister. Oribela struggles to adapt to this new life and tries everything to escape.

Summary

Desmundo is a 2002 Brazilian drama film directed by Alain Fresnot. Set in 1570, it tells the story of Oribela, a young Portuguese woman who travels to Brazil to marry Francisco de Albuquerque, a rude sugar cane plantation owner. The movie explores themes of cultural adjustment, marriage dynamics, and the struggle for independence.
